Bokeh
Development
Bokeh is an interactive data visualization library for Python that targets modern web browsers for presentation. It offers elegant, concise construction of versatile graphics, and affords high-performance interactivity over large or streaming datasets.

Vector Linux
Os & Utilities
Vector Linux is a lightweight Linux distribution based on Slackware that focuses on speed, efficiency, and ease of use. It uses the Xfce desktop environment and includes popular open source applications.
